A touch of the Spice comes to Surrey

Niroopa Moorthy married Matt Sawyer in a traditional Hindu ceremony followed by a civil wedding an reception the next day.

Matt and Niroopa's WeddingHow did you and Matt meet?

We met on new years eve, 2002. Matt went to university with a friend of mine from school. After a couple of months of trying to find him a girlfriend, we started dating!

How did Matt propose?

We were out in a local bar with a friend of mine, the night the clocks went forward in spring, 2006. When the two of us came home we decided to open a bottle or two of wine, Matt disappeared and I decided to walk round the house trying to drunkenly change the clocks! When he came back he got down on one knee in our front room and I promptly burst into tears! He proposed, I said yes...and the rest is history!!!

Where did you get your wedding outfits from?

We went to New Delhi in Jan 2007, where we got all the outfits for me and Matt. My reception outfit was bought in Wembley at RCKC.

Tell us about the flowers you chose...

For the Hindu wedding, my aunt made the garlands, which consisted of maroon, cream and gold carnations, and the bridesmaids bouquets, which were maroon and cream roses. At the civil wedding, my bouquet had cream roses which matched the button holes of the groom and best man.

What will be your lasting memory of your big day?

he weekend went by so quickly, but what I will remember most is getting choked up Matt and Niroopa's weddingwith emotion as I was saying my vows, and Matt comforting me in front of everyone.

Where did you go on your honeymoon?

We had a surprise honeymoon courtesy of my parents and went to Istanbul for four days and then Bodrum for four days.
A perfect way to end a perfect wedding!

What is the one piece of advice you would give to other Mrs2Be's?

Stay calm, there are other people there to get stressed for you! The day will go so quickly you need to be able to remember everything!!
